Output c28734963f49d475b12ae1978058e99e690f1104eb2ea45c17baff9c8e805a93:1

value
1003150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5789512ab985033b99f9a5216b4a026740dcc3e OP_EQUAL
address
3M9kJcKkQ3GS5WzVYSVCitsoZjzEjnDWMy
transaction
c28734963f49d475b12ae1978058e99e690f1104eb2ea45c17baff9c8e805a93